How to prepare for a job interview at Capital R2R Limited
✨Know Your Stuff
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of IT recruitment. Understand the latest trends, technologies, and challenges in the industry. This will not only help you answer questions confidently but also show that you're genuinely interested in the role.
✨Showcase Your Success
Prepare to discuss your previous achievements as a recruitment consultant. Have specific examples ready that highlight your ability to source candidates, build relationships, and close deals. Numbers speak volumes, so if you can, quantify your successes!
✨Be Personable
Since this role involves building long-term relationships, it's crucial to demonstrate your interpersonal skills. Be friendly, approachable, and engage with your interviewers. Show them that you can connect with clients and candidates alike.
✨Ask Smart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ions about the company’s growth plans and team dynamics. This shows that you’re not just interested in the job, but also in how you can contribute to their success. Plus, it gives you a chance to assess if the company is the right fit for you.
